- who: Jorge Poveda from the Department of Production and Forest Resources, University Institute for Research in Sustainable Forest Spain have published the research work: A potential role of salicylic acid in the evolutionary behavior of Trichoderma as a plant pathogen: from Marchantia polymorpha to Arabidopsis thaliana, in the Journal: (JOURNAL)
- what: The aim of this work was to study the effect of different Trichoderma species on direct and indirect interaction with M. polymorpha; to determine the plant defense responses involved in this interaction, to check the similarities with more evolved vascular plants such as pteridophytes . . .
